Often the washer nozzles can get clogged. If you hear the washer pump running, you need to disconncect the small hose from the washer nozzle, and see if you get fluid pumped thru it when you hit your washer switch. If so, you need to unclog or replace the nozzle, and if no fluid is pumped out the hose, you need to remove and inspect the washer pump, as it might be dirty, or failed.
